My notes for the episode: -In response to Theta's criticism of my list of the True Magics, while I understand his frustration with the fact that nothing is known about the Fourth, the list I provided is the actual ordered list of the 5 True Magics and each True Magic is also referred to by its respective number as an official title (i.e. in the Witch on the Holy Night the "Fifth Magic" is literally called the "Fifth Magic" in the story). Typemoon lore is very complicated and detailed, but there are often concepts or items left vague or unanswered that are addressed in separate works. -In regards to Gilgamesh possessing the "prototypes" of almost all other Noble Phantasms I'll provide some more detail. In the Typemoon Universe when it comes to magecraft and magecraft related items like Noble Phantasms the general rule of thumb is that the older that magecraft's origin is, the more superior it is to more recently developed magecraft. In this world while science is constantly moving forward, magecraft is constantly moving backwards or trying to rediscover its peak during the Age of Gods. When Gilgamesh was alive he collected all the treasures in the world, which included most (but not all) of the weapon noble phantasms in existence before they had received the names that would be associated with them in legend. Because the "prototypes" he owns are older than the weapons more recent servants use as noble phantasms they are technically superior even though core abilities of the weapons are the same (i.e. he probably has Lancer's two spears but if you were to compare them Gilgamesh's would be superior because they are older). Gilgamesh's noble phantasm Gate of Babylon is literally the storehouse where all the treasures he collected during his life were kept. -Gilgamesh was humanity's first hero and first king in this world and during life he considered himself the ruler of all of humanity and the entire planet and he therefore believes that everything on Earth is literally under his rule and he is free to do with it as he pleases. -In general, Servants are people whose actions in life were so profound and had such an impact on humanity that it resulted in their souls being removed from the cycle of reincarnation and being inscribed/stored in the Throne of Heroes which is a metaphysical place that exists outside of space and time, turning them into a Heroic Spirit. Saber is an exception to this and Lessons might not know why since he didn't see the first couple of episodes explaining how Saber has been summoned from literally before she died historically in the past. -The Magic Circuits a mage possesses allow a mage to draw in mana from the environment and convert it into magical energy which can be used to either fuel spells or enable Servants to stay materialized. It is possible to draw in and use more mana than one's capacity and cast a spell exceeding that capacity but that will cause damage to the mage's body or magic circuits and even risks death. Mana is drawn from the natural world around a mage and not created within a mage's body and it is possible for all the ambient mana in an area to be used up if enough magecraft is used, but that ambient mana will replenish overtime. -If a servant is summoned for multiple Holy Grail wars, those servants don't retain any memories from prior Holy Grail wars, but there are exceptions to this rule. -After Kiritsugu pulled the fire alarm at the hotel, there was a hotel employee walking around confirming everyone evacuated and Kiritsugu hypnotized him into checking off that Lord El Melloi and his wife had evacuated. -Kayneth's title of "Lord" marked him as one of the highest ranked mages in the Clock Tower/Mage's Association. -the "Wolverine claws" Theta mentioned that Kirei uses are called "Black Keys" and are weapons used by the Holy Church when fighting enemies. -the woman who was with Rin when her father visited was her mother. -Sakura being made a "sacrifice" to the Matous is not as well explained in the anime as it is in the light novel of Fate Zero. The context you're missing is that both Rin and Sakura were born with especially high potential that was very unique in the magecraft world. In this world, only the official successor of a family of magi associated with the Magic Association is given protection from the Association essentially capturing particularly unique mages to use study as specimens and try and find a way to understand their unique magic/abilities. This meant that since Rin would be the official heir, Sakura was at risk of a capture and experimentation on by the Mage's Association, but by letting the Matous adopt her to become the heir to their magic she would have that same protection, and since mages work hard to keep how their magic works secret from other mages Tokiomi probably assumes Sakura is getting trained similar to how Rin is. This means that Kirei might have a wish he seeks and he would not need to kill Gilgamesh to use the Grail for that purpose. -Kirei's wife was the one who died recently when the show started. -the reason why Irisviel's condition has been deteriorating over time is not simply because time has been passing but is because each time a Servant dies, instead of simply returning to the Throne of Heroes its soul is absorbed by the Grail and converted into magic energy. Every time a Servant died, Irisviel's condition would get worse because she was now absorbing that Servant's soul as the Grail. If I remember the timeline correctly: 1. after Assassin died she started losing her physical strength and feeling in her hands which is why Saber had to start driving for her, 2. then Caster and Lancer died in short order which led to her collapsing shortly after Lancer's death and her current weakness in this episode.
